In the world of materials handling, safety, productivity and job satisfaction are inextricably linked and new AI-based Driver Safety System (DSS) technology solutions for forklifts aim to lend a helping hand in reducing stress for both employees and management by alerting the driver when they detect signs of fatigue, distraction, and dangerous behaviors such as smoking and smart phone usage.
More Safety and Security Equals Less Stress and More Productivity
Factory floors and warehouses packed with people, and potentially dangerous heavy equipment, generate additional stresses that impact almost everyone and every task, are a prime place for AI to assist. While white collar cubicle workers share productivity and efficiency stress with warehouse floor workers, they’re not living with the additional danger of potentially incurring or causing physical harm to either themselves or a coworker. Forklift drivers, their managers and coworkers on the busy warehouse floor live with this added stress every single shift.
The ubiquitous forklift – both essential workhorse and leading safety threat – therefore immediately presents itself as the first and most practical beachhead from where to start improving safety and security in the industrial workplace. Smarter AI-assisted forklifts can be more aware and sensitive to their surroundings, and communicate more effectively with their operators, managers and nearby coworkers. More awareness, increased sensitivity and better communication are foundational principles in improving working environments, reducing stress and encouraging increased productivity.

Evolution or Revolution?
If forklifts are the “tip-of-the-spear” to smarter, safer and more productive work environments, then they are going to need to become a lot more sensitive and smarter with the help of AI.
There are two simple and obvious approaches to smarter AI-assisted forklifts. Firstly, design, build and buy smart, sensitive and communicative custom forklifts from scratch or, alternatively, add smarts to the giant population of forklifts currently in use. Both approaches have been happening for a while, and notably, both also further benefit from smarter (read as IoT connected) warehouse buildings, shelves, packaging, products and staff.
There are scenarios where the scale, complexity and economics of the task warrant new smart-from-scratch AI forklifts operating in hyper-intelligent and connected warehouses. However, the more practical choice for most businesses already racing along at high speed, with significant equipment sunk costs, is probably to work with their existing equipment and environments. They’ll need to take a more evolution-like approach to a smarter, safer, and more productive work environment where solutions match appropriate gains with suitable investments of time, energy, and money.
